Why voice search is not the same as text search
Text search is typically brief and keyword-based. Voice search, however, is conversational. It incorporates complete sentences and question-like prompts. For example:
- Text search: “weather Delhi today”
- Voice search: “How is the weather in Delhi today?”
That means marketers have to think about natural language, not just short words or phrases.
CACH Library of Key Techniques for Voice Search Optimisation
1. Focus on Conversational Keywords
Marketers must leverage long-tail and question-based keywords. Content should naturally provide answers to questions. Including phrases such as “how,” “what,” “where” and “best” makes it easier to match intent with voice search.
2. Optimise for Local Search
Most voice searches are location-based. People do “near me” searches. Businesses also need to make sure their Google Business Profile includes their current address, phone number, and hours of operation.
3. Website Speed and Mobile-Friendly Will Get An Uplift
Voice searches are predominantly conducted on mobile. Because a slow or non-mobile-friendly site can scare away users. Websites must load quickly and work well on smartphones.
4. Use Featured Snippets and FAQs
Search engines commonly read featured snippets as voice answers. Short and concise answers in the FAQ pages increases the probability of being considered to answer verbally.
5. Structure Content for Voice
Content should be scannable. Use bullets, short paragraphs and headings. For best results, feed voice search with direct answers.
6. Focus on Natural Language Processing (NLP)
NLP is what allows AI assistants to interpret human language. As a marketer, you want to write conversationally. This helps content be more applicable to voice questions.
Tools to Assist Marketers with Voice Search
- Answer The Public: It assists in finding some of the most researched questions on the internet.
- SEMRush: Keywords trends and voice search included.
- Google Search Console: Displays how users discover your website.
- Local SEO tools: Assist in managing business listings on location-based searches.
